Notes: Printer's name anglicised from Latin imprint. Latin preface signed J.M.P ie. John Mansell, vice-chancellor [Case] Greek and Latin verse by fellows of the Cambridge colleges on the death of James I and the accession of Charles I. Another imprint [see STC 4478] contains a number of extra poems at the end of the collection [from p. 57 forward].
